EFeCr-A8 High-Chromium Hardfacing Electrode

 

Ocean Welding EFeCr-A8 is a high-chromium iron-carbon (Fe-Cr-C) alloy hardfacing electrode designed for manual arc hardfacing applications on components subjected to severe abrasive wear and light-to-moderate impact. Compliant with AWS A5.13 EFeCr-A1 and GB/T 984 EDZCr-C-15 standards, the deposited metal contains 25%–32% chromium and 2.5%–5.0% carbon. It forms a dense, network-like structure of primary M7C3-type chromium carbides within an austenite-martensite matrix, achieving an as-welded hardness of HRC 58–62.

 

EFeCr-A8 is the industry-preferred single-electrode solution for hardfacing wear parts such as excavator bucket teeth, crusher hammers and jaw plates, cement mill rollers, mixing blades, agricultural plowshares, conveyor screws, and slurry pump components. Applications and Industries

 

IndustryComponentWear mechanism
Mining & CrushingJaw & cone crusher jaws / hammers / linersSevere abrasion + moderate impact
CementVertical mill rollers, roller-press tyres, concrete-pump pipeAbrasion + fatigue
AgriculturePlow shares, rotary tiller blades, mulcher hammersSoil / sand abrasion
Earth-movingExcavator bucket teeth (with EFeMn-A buttering), bulldozer cutting edgesImpact + abrasion
Steel & SinteringSinter feeder blades, blast-furnace bell rings, ball-mill linersHigh-temp abrasion (< 500 °C)
PetrochemicalCentrifugal cracker pump sleeves & linersAbrasion + corrosion + cavitation
Power / ChemicalSlurry pump impellers, agitator blades, screw conveyorsAbrasion + corrosion

Not recommended for use in the case of severe repeated impact under large ore feed conditions. First, use EFeMn-A / D256 austenitic manganese steel welding rods for the root pass (buffer layer) welding, and then use EFeCr-A8 welding rods for the wear-resistant surface layer welding.

 

Chemical Composition of All-Weld Metal (wt %)

 

ElementGB/T 984 EDZCr-C-15 (spec)AWS A5.13 EFeCr-A1OW-EFeCr-A8 typical
C2.50 – 5.002.0 – 5.53.40
Cr25.00 – 32.0024.0 – 33.028.85
Ni3.00 – 5.00≤ 5.03.80
Mn≤ 8.00≤ 3.03.50
Si1.00 – 4.80≤ 2.01.67
Mo0 – 1.5 (optional)0.5 (optional grade)
Nb / V0 – 1.5 (optional, secondary MC carbides)on request
P≤ 0.040≤ 0.040.02
S≤ 0.030≤ 0.030.01
Febalancebalancebalance

Microstructure: Primary M7C3 chromium carbides (volume fraction of 30%–45%) with a hexagonal crystal structure are distributed within a mixed austenite/martensite matrix. The appearance of regular stress-relief cracks on the surface of the weld overlay is a normal phenomenon. These cracks can release thermal stress and will not propagate into the base material.

 

Mechanical and physical properties

 

PropertyValue
As-welded hardness (3 layers, undiluted)HRC 58 – 62 (peak 65 in high-C grade)
Single-layer hardness (with base metal dilution)HRC 48 – 52
Work-hardening effectNone (unlike EFeMn family)
Service temperature limit≤ 500 °C (hardness drops sharply above this)
Impact toughnessLow - brittle deposit, not for shock loading

 

Welding Parameters and Best Practices

 

Polarity: DC electrode positive (DCEP / DC+) only. AC not recommended for the low-hydrogen basic coating.
Positions: PA (flat) and PB (horizontal) - hardfacing electrodes are not designed for vertical or overhead.

Diameter × LengthDCEP amperageVoltageBead length
Ø 3.2 × 350 mm90 – 130 A22–26 V≤ 50–70 mm
Ø 4.0 × 350 mm120 – 170 A24–28 V≤ 50–70 mm
Ø 5.0 × 350 mm140 – 210 A26–30 V≤ 50–70 mm
